PLL type estimator applied in PMSM sensorless control for speed and position

This paper presents a novel estimation algorithm for speed and position of Permanent Magnet Synchronous Machine (PMSM) based on Phase Locked Loop (PLL) technique. The invention in this sensorless control scheme combines the PLL methodology with a modified PMSM mathematical model expressed in the arbitrary rotating frame. Only stator voltages and currents are required in the algorithm estimating modified stator and rotor magnetic flux. The control strategy principle is based on the advantage of PLL-type structure to successfully track rotor flux with the required stability and accuracy. Simulation results demonstrate the effectiveness and performance analysis of the proposed position and speed estimation method.
